OW NASA MODIS Photosynthetically Available Radiation (PAR)

Description

The dataset contains satellite-derived sea-surface Photosynthetically Available Radiation (PAR) measurements collected by means of the Moderate Resolution Imaging Spectroradiometer (MODIS) sensor onboard the NASA Aqua satellite. The data is available at monthly (2002 - present) intervals at a spatial resolution of 0.05 degrees. The geographic coverage is global.
